Source code for vivarium.engine.framework.engine

"""
===================
The Vivarium Engine
===================

The engine houses the :class:`SimulationContext` -- the key ``vivarium`` object
for running and interacting with simulations. It is the top level manager
for all state information in ``vivarium``.  By intention, it exposes a very
simple interface for managing the
:ref:`simulation lifecycle <lifecycle_concept>`.

Also included here is the simulation :class:`Builder`, which is the main
interface that components use to interact with the simulation framework. You
can read more about how the builder works and what services is exposes
:ref:`here <builder_concept>`.

Finally, there are a handful of wrapper methods that allow a user or user
tools to easily setup and run a simulation.

"""

[docs] class SimulationContext: _created_simulation_contexts: set[str] = set() @staticmethod def _get_context_name(sim_name: str | None) -> str: """Gets a unique name for a simulation context. Parameters ---------- sim_name The name of the simulation context. If None, a unique name will be generated. Returns ------- A unique name for the simulation context. Notes ----- This method mutates process global state (the class attribute ``_created_simulation_contexts``) in order to keep track contexts that have been generated. This functionality makes generating simulation contexts in parallel a non-threadsafe operation. """ if sim_name is None: sim_number = len(SimulationContext._created_simulation_contexts) + 1 sim_name = f"simulation_{sim_number}" if sim_name in SimulationContext._created_simulation_contexts: msg = ( "Attempting to create two SimulationContexts " f"with the same name {sim_name}" ) raise VivariumError(msg) SimulationContext._created_simulation_contexts.add(sim_name) return sim_name @staticmethod def _clear_context_cache() -> None: """Clears the cache of simulation context names. Notes ----- This is primarily useful for testing purposes. """ SimulationContext._created_simulation_contexts = set() def __init__( self, model_specification: str | Path | ConfigTree | None = None, components: list[Component] | dict[str, Any] | ConfigTree | None = None, configuration: dict[str, Any] | ConfigTree | None = None, plugin_configuration: dict[str, Any] | ConfigTree | None = None, sim_name: str | None = None, logging_verbosity: int = 1, ) -> None: self._name = self._get_context_name(sim_name) # Bootstrap phase: Parse arguments, make private managers component_configuration = ( components if isinstance(components, (dict, ConfigTree)) else None ) self._additional_components = components if isinstance(components, list) else [] self.model_specification = build_model_specification( model_specification, component_configuration, configuration, plugin_configuration ) self._plugin_configuration = self.model_specification.plugins self._component_configuration = self.model_specification.components self.configuration = self.model_specification.configuration self._plugin_manager = PluginManager(self.model_specification.plugins) self._logging =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(LoggingManager) self._logging.configure_logging( simulation_name=self.name, verbosity=logging_verbosity, ) self._logger = self._logging.get_logger() self._builder = Builder(self.configuration, self._plugin_manager) # This formally starts the initialization phase (this call makes the # life-cycle manager). self._lifecycle =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(LifeCycleManager) self._lifecycle.add_phase( "setup", [ lifecycle_states.SETUP, lifecycle_states.POST_SETUP, lifecycle_states.POPULATION_CREATION, ], ) self._lifecycle.add_phase( "main_loop", [ lifecycle_states.TIME_STEP_PREPARE, lifecycle_states.TIME_STEP, lifecycle_states.TIME_STEP_CLEANUP, lifecycle_states.COLLECT_METRICS, ], loop=True, ) self._lifecycle.add_phase( "simulation_end", [lifecycle_states.SIMULATION_END, lifecycle_states.REPORT] ) self._component_manager =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(ComponentManager) self._component_manager.setup_manager(self.configuration, self._lifecycle) self._clock =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(SimulationClock) self._values =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(ValuesManager) self._events =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(EventManager) self._population =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(PopulationManager) self._resource =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(ResourceManager) self._results =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(ResultsManager) self._tables =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(LookupTableManager) self._randomness =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(RandomnessManager) self._data = self._plugin_manager.get_plugin(ArtifactManager) optional_managers = self._plugin_manager.get_optional_controllers() for name in optional_managers: setattr(self, f"_{name}", optional_managers[name]) # The order the managers are added is important. It represents the # order in which they will be set up. The logging manager and the clock are # required by several of the other managers, including the lifecycle manager. The # lifecycle manager is also required by most managers. The randomness # manager requires the population manager. The remaining managers need # no ordering. managers = [ self._logging, self._lifecycle, self._resource, self._values, self._population, self._clock, self._randomness, self._events, self._tables, self._data, self._results, *self._plugin_manager.get_optional_controllers().values(), ] self._component_manager.add_managers(managers) component_config_parser = self._plugin_manager.get_component_config_parser() # Tack extra components onto the end of the list generated from the model specification. components_list: list[Component] = ( component_config_parser.get_components(self._component_configuration) + self._additional_components ) non_components = [obj for obj in components_list if not isinstance(obj, Component)] if non_components: message = ( "Attempting to create a simulation with the following components " "that do not inherit from `vivarium.engine.Component`: " f"[{[c.name for c in non_components]}]." ) raise ComponentConfigError(message) self._lifecycle.add_constraint( self.add_components, allow_during=[lifecycle_states.INITIALIZATION] ) self.add_components(components_list) @property def name(self) -> str: return self._name @property def current_time(self) -> ClockTime: """Returns the current simulation time.""" return self._clock.time
[docs] def get_results(self) -> dict[str, pd.DataFrame]: """Returns a dictionary of formatted results.""" return self._results.get_results()
[docs] def run_simulation(self) -> None: """Runs all steps of a simulation.""" self.setup() self.initialize_simulants() self.run() self.finalize() self.report()
[docs] def setup(self) -> None: self._lifecycle.set_state(lifecycle_states.SETUP) self.configuration.freeze() self._component_manager.setup_components(self._builder) self.simulant_creator = self._builder.population.get_simulant_creator() self.get_population_index = self._builder.population.get_population_index() self.time_step_events = self._lifecycle.get_state_names("main_loop") self.time_step_emitters = { k: self._builder.event.get_emitter(k) for k in self.time_step_events } self.end_emitter = self._builder.event.get_emitter(lifecycle_states.SIMULATION_END) self.report_emitter = self._builder.event.get_emitter(lifecycle_states.REPORT) post_setup = self._builder.event.get_emitter(lifecycle_states.POST_SETUP) self._lifecycle.set_state(lifecycle_states.POST_SETUP) post_setup(pd.Index([]), None)
[docs] def initialize_simulants(self) -> None: self._lifecycle.set_state(lifecycle_states.POPULATION_CREATION) pop_params = self.configuration.population # Fencepost the creation of the initial population. self._clock.step_backward() population_size = pop_params.population_size self.simulant_creator(population_size, {"sim_state": lifecycle_states.SETUP}) self._clock.step_forward(self.get_population_index())
[docs] def step(self) -> None: self._logger.info(self.current_time) for event in self.time_step_events: self._logger.debug(f"Event: {event}") self._lifecycle.set_state(event) pop_to_update = self._clock.get_active_simulants( self.get_population_index(), self._clock.event_time, ) self._logger.debug(f"Updating: {len(pop_to_update)}") self.time_step_emitters[event](pop_to_update, None) self._clock.step_forward(self.get_population_index())
[docs] def run( self, backup_path: Path | None = None, backup_freq: int | float | None = None, ) -> None: if backup_freq and backup_path: time_to_save = time() + backup_freq while self.current_time < self._clock.stop_time: # type: ignore [operator] self.step() if time() >= time_to_save: self._logger.debug(f"Writing Simulation Backup to {backup_path}") self.write_backup(backup_path) time_to_save = time() + backup_freq else: while self.current_time < self._clock.stop_time: # type: ignore [operator] self.step()
[docs] def finalize(self) -> None: self._lifecycle.set_state(lifecycle_states.SIMULATION_END) self.end_emitter(self.get_population_index(), None) unused_config_keys = self.configuration.unused_keys() if unused_config_keys: self._logger.warning( f"Some configuration keys not used during run: {unused_config_keys}." )
[docs] def report(self, print_results: bool = True) -> None: self._lifecycle.set_state(lifecycle_states.REPORT) self.report_emitter(self.get_population_index(), None) results = self.get_results() if print_results: for measure, df in results.items(): self._logger.info(f"\n{measure}:\n{pformat(df)}") performance_metrics = self.get_performance_metrics() performance_metrics_str: str = performance_metrics.to_string( index=False, float_format=lambda x: f"{x:.2f}", ) self._logger.info("\n" + performance_metrics_str) self._write_results(results)
def _write_results(self, results: dict[str, pd.DataFrame]) -> None: """Iterates through the measures and writes out the formatted results.""" try: results_dir = self.configuration.output_data.results_directory for measure, df in results.items(): output_file = Path(results_dir) / f"{measure}.parquet" df.to_parquet(output_file, index=False) except ConfigurationKeyError: self._logger.info("No results directory set; results are not written to disk.")
[docs] def write_backup(self, backup_path: Path) -> None: with open(backup_path, "wb") as f: dill.dump(self, f, protocol=dill.HIGHEST_PROTOCOL)
[docs] def get_performance_metrics(self) -> pd.DataFrame: timing_dict = self._lifecycle.timings total_time = np.sum([np.sum(v) for v in timing_dict.values()]) timing_dict["total"] = [total_time] records = [ { "Event": label, "Count": len(ts), "Mean time (s)": np.mean(ts), "Std. dev. time (s)": np.std(ts), "Total time (s)": sum(ts), "% Total time": 100 * sum(ts) / total_time, } for label, ts in timing_dict.items() ] performance_metrics = pd.DataFrame(records) return performance_metrics
[docs] def add_components(self, component_list: list[Component]) -> None: """Adds new components to the simulation.""" self._component_manager.add_components(component_list)
def __repr__(self) -> str: return f"SimulationContext({self.name})"
[docs] def get_number_of_steps_remaining(self) -> int: return self._clock.time_steps_remaining
[docs] @classmethod def load_from_backup(cls, backup_path: Path) -> "SimulationContext": """Loads a simulation context from a backup file.""" with open(backup_path, "rb") as f: backup: SimulationContext = dill.load(f) return backup
[docs] class Builder: """Toolbox for constructing and configuring simulation components. This is the access point for components through which they are able to utilize a variety of interfaces to interact with the simulation framework. Notes ----- A `Builder` should never be created directly. It will automatically be created during the initialization of a :class:`SimulationContext` """ def __init__(self, configuration: ConfigTree, plugin_manager: PluginManager) -> None: self.configuration = configuration """Provides access to the :ref:`configuration<configuration_concept>`""" self.logging =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(LoggingInterface) """Provides access to the :ref:`logging<logging_concept>` system.""" self.lookup =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(LookupTableInterface) """Provides access to simulant-specific data via the :ref:`lookup table<lookup_concept>` abstraction.""" self.value =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(ValuesInterface) """Provides access to computed simulant attribute values via the :ref:`value pipeline<values_concept>` system.""" self.event =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(EventInterface) """Provides access to event listeners utilized in the :ref:`event<event_concept>` system.""" self.population =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(PopulationInterface) """Provides access to population state table via the :ref:`population<population_concept>` system.""" self.resources =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(ResourceInterface) """Provides access to the :ref:`resource<resource_concept>` system, which manages dependencies between components. """ self.results =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(ResultsInterface) """Provides access to the :ref:`results<results_concept>` system.""" self.randomness =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(RandomnessInterface) """Provides access to the :ref:`randomness<crn_concept>` system.""" self.time: TimeInterface =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(TimeInterface) """Provides access to the simulation's :ref:`clock<time_concept>`.""" self.components =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(ComponentInterface) """Provides access to the :ref:`component management<components_concept>` system, which maintains a reference to all managers and components in the simulation.""" self.lifecycle =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(LifeCycleInterface) """Provides access to the :ref:`life-cycle<lifecycle_concept>` system, which manages the simulation's execution life-cycle.""" self.data = plugin_manager.get_plugin_interface(ArtifactInterface) """Provides access to the simulation's input data housed in the :ref:`data artifact<data_concept>`.""" for name, interface in plugin_manager.get_optional_interfaces().items(): setattr(self, name, interface) def __repr__(self) -> str: return "Builder()"
